A Brief History of Coil Springs

The journey of coil springs traces back centuries, with early examples appearing in door locks during the 15th century. These ingenious devices marked the beginning of a revolution, leading to the development of spring-powered clocks and watches in the following centuries. The 17th century witnessed the groundbreaking work of British physicist Robert Hooke, who formulated Hooke's Law, a fundamental principle that governs the behavior of springs.

Types of Coil Springs: A Diverse Family

Coil springs come in a variety of shapes and sizes, each tailored to specific applications. Some of the most common types include:

Compression Springs: These are the most familiar type, designed to compress under load. Think of the spring in a ballpoint pen or the ones used in car suspensions. They shorten when force is applied and return to their original length when released.

Tension Springs: Unlike compression springs, tension springs are designed to stretch under load. They're often found in garage door openers, clothespins, and retractable measuring tapes. They lengthen when force is applied and contract back to their original length when released.

Torsion Springs: These springs are designed to twist under load. Imagine the spring inside a wind-up toy. They rotate when force is applied and return to their original position when released.

Variable-Rate Springs: These springs offer a varying resistance to compression, allowing for greater control and smoother performance in applications such as automotive suspensions and industrial machinery.

The Physics Behind the Coil Spring's Power

At the heart of the coil spring's functionality lies Hooke's Law, a fundamental principle in physics. It states that the force exerted by a spring is directly proportional to its extension or compression. This means that the more you stretch or compress a spring, the more force it will exert.

Mathematically, this can be represented as:

F = -kx

Where:

F is the force exerted by the spring

k is the spring constant (a measure of the spring's stiffness)

x is the displacement from the spring's equilibrium position

The negative sign indicates that the force exerted by the spring is always in the opposite direction to the displacement.

Applications of Coil Springs: Ubiquitous in Everyday Life

Coil springs, with their versatility and reliability, are essential components in countless applications, touching our lives in numerous ways.

Automotive Industry: Coil springs are integral to car suspensions, providing a smooth ride and absorbing shocks from bumps and uneven surfaces.

Household Appliances: From the springs in your refrigerator door to the ones in your washing machine, coil springs ensure smooth operation and prevent wear and tear.

Office Equipment: Coil springs are found in pens, staplers, paper clips, and other office supplies, providing reliable and consistent performance.

Electronics and Gadgets: From the spring-loaded buttons on your phone to the mechanisms in your laptop, coil springs contribute to the functionality of countless electronic devices.

Industrial Machinery: Coil springs are used in countless industrial applications, such as heavy machinery, presses, and conveyors, providing stability, shock absorption, and resilience.
